Welcome to on-call for PortionPal, our recipe-scaling calculator! Most pages are false alarms from the metric-conversion worker, so don't panic. You'll need local access to the scaling API before you can replay failed jobs. Copy env.sample to .env in the portionpal-api repo, then add the signing secret on the next line.

vault entry, yahif-yajep: COURIER_KEY29=b802bdf8034096b65a51c6ba5abe2

**Q: How do I tail service logs during review?**

Use `tailrig` with the service slug: `tailrig follow payments-core --env staging`. It streams structured logs with built-in filtering (`--level`, `--grep`). Don't use raw `kubectl logs` against shared clusters; tailrig enforces read-only scopes and redacts sensitive fields automatically.

For reviewing a specific deploy, pass `--since-deploy` to scope output to the candidate build.

Full flag reference and troubleshooting steps are on the internal tooling page.

wiki page, tagef-bajog: https://grafana.nelvrocorp.corp/projects/pages/display/fa238a928afe

## Authentication

Heads up: the nightly reindex job (`reindex_nightly.py`) talks to the Lanternfish search cluster, and that cluster won't accept anonymous writes anymore — we locked it down last sprint. The job now authenticates as the `reindex-runner` service identity against Corvid Gateway, and the token is injected via the `LF_INDEX_TOKEN` env var in the scheduler config. Nothing clever going on, just a bearer header on every batch request. For review purposes, the staging credential currently in use is listed below.

service key, kadug-kadup: kto15_rN23XLAYImmZgrJ

TICKET-4471: Config drift on Quertal query planner, staging vs prod. Staging picked up the new join-reorder heuristics; prod still runs the old cost model. Result: the Marblegate reporting queries regressed ~40% on prod after the partial rollout, since planner hints assume the new model. Bisected to the drift, not the code. Reviewer: please confirm the diff below matches what we intend to pin before I open the sync PR. Current prod values for the planner service follow.

config for kafof-bawef:
holath:
  log_level: debug
  metrics_host: metrics.holath.qorvelsys.internal
  pin: 2191
  pool_size: 32